Hello Mr. Gutierrez! Since you are a true and rare professional I wonder if you can give an opinion. I have a U660F Toyota transmission that have some issues. It doesn't show any code yet. When shifting from 2 to 3 the engine revs high on his own. Also, from 3 to 2 it's a little hursh. I changed the fluid and 2 to 3 it's a little better but 3 to 2 it's a little worse. I mesured resistance on solenoids and it's ok. After the engine warms up the problems it is almost unnoticeble. What do you recomand?
The bonded pistons wear on these units. You may end up doing a rebuild on this one. But I strongly recommend installing all new bonded pistons. They leak. And that's probably what it's going on with your unit now. It will get worse before it will get better.
